What are the Signs of a Bad Starter?
Signs of a bad starter many times means, obviously, a starter problem or a faulty component. Hence, whenever you feel like the starter is giving problems carry out a few tests yourself to know where the problem lies. Mentioned below are few of the signs of a bad starter. • One of the simplest sign is no response or cranking noise. When you turn the key to ignition for starting the engine, you may either get no response or it will make a cranking noise. • It would be wise to check if it is a battery problem or what. To check this, switch on the interior lights and the headlights. If the light is dim it means that battery is the problem, if not then there may be some problem with the starter. Most of the times, starter problem arises because of an electrical problem. • Labored or slow cranking is also one of the signs of a bad starter.
